Taking a Spin in Waymo’s Self-Driving Car

Taking a Spin in Waymo’s Self-Driving Car
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ter


The white Jaguar with a cumbersome prime headed towards me on the busy streets of Austin, Texas. A few block away, it stopped at a cease signal. There have been no automobiles on the cross road, so the electrical car proceeded to maneuver and rolled to a cease proper in entrance of me, turning on its hazard lights.

Welcome to Waymo One, a self-driving automobile service owned by Google guardian firm Alphabet. And on one Tuesday morning, it was my Uber experience as properly.

Alphabet’s autonomous car (AV) division, Waymo, has partnered with Uber to carry self-driving automobiles to the general public. It’s obtainable in Phoenix. Final week, it started deploying in Austin, with Atlanta coming subsequent.

Uber provided to let me attempt it, accompanied by spokesman Conor Ferguson. He mentioned Uber has partnered with different AV corporations as properly to supply rides.

To name an AV, riders need to allow autonomous automobiles within the Uber app. Nonetheless, there’s no assure you’ll get a Waymo. It really works like an everyday Uber experience; you don’t know which driver you’ll be getting. Waymo is accessible on UberX, Uber Inexperienced, Uber Consolation or Uber Consolation Electrical.

The price is similar as an Uber experience, besides no tipping. Vehicles can be found 24/7, solely returning to Uber’s house base for upkeep and charging. (Alternatively, you may order it on the Waymo One app in San Francisco, Phoenix and Los Angeles. In Austin, it’s solely obtainable via Uber.)

Preliminary Jitters

My first dilemma: How do I open the door? The door handles on the Jaguar I-PACE are flush with the automobile door, just like the retractable ones on Teslas. It seems riders have to make use of the Uber app. Click on. The door handles come out.

As you get into the automobile, Waymo greets you by title. Inside, it appears to be like like a typical automobile inside, with leather-based seats. There’s a console in between the entrance seats the place the rider can begin the experience, change or add stops to the vacation spot and even select the music channel.

There is no such thing as a human driver, which prompted a second of concern, then surprise. If anybody tries to sit down within the driver’s seat or contact the steering wheel and different controls, the experience will cease. If a rider is uncomfortable, they’ll press the “pull over” or “help” button.

Waymo is ready to traverse a 37-mile radius round downtown Austin as a totally autonomous car — no human drivers or fleet managers behind the scenes. Nevertheless it doesn’t drive on freeways and, for some purpose, can not go to most airports, in response to Ferguson.

In a pleasing feminine voice, Waymo reminds passengers to placed on seat belts, and away we went. My preliminary response was, “How secure is that this experience?” However a couple of minutes into the experience, as I noticed how deftly Waymo was driving, I relaxed and thought, “I can get used to this.”

Waymo slowed down at pace bumps, placed on flip alerts and stopped at visitors alerts. On my experience, it drove as quick as 35 miles per hour on metropolis streets. I used to be shocked by this; I assumed self-driving automobiles could be gradual to maximise security, like my expertise with a robotaxi in Florida. The Waymo automobile accelerated and slowed down like a human driver.

The within console exhibits you the route you’re on and its environment in actual time, together with close by automobiles, a bike owner passing the automobile, cease indicators and a few landmarks. It exhibits you what Waymo is seeing — within the muted greys and blues of a digital map, along with your route in inexperienced.

Waymo “sees” via the LiDAR sensors on prime of the automobile, which resemble a cumbersome crown. They always spin and use laser gentle to create a 3D map of the environment. The LiDAR emits laser pulses and measures the time it takes to bounce again from objects to create the map. Waymo additionally makes use of cameras and radar sensors to assist with navigation and object detection.

After the experience, Waymo reminds you to assemble your belongings as a result of “your future self will thanks.”

Waymo vs Cruise and Tesla

Waymo is probably the most superior autonomous car firm providing rides to the general public. Its automobiles function at Stage 4, the place the automobile can drive itself however is restricted to an space, in response to a definition of autonomous ranges by the Nationwide Freeway Site visitors Administration. Which means no human drivers are guiding the car, both within the automobile or remotely.

Stage 5 is the best stage of auto automation: Which means the automobile can drive itself anyplace, below all situations and varieties of roads. There is no such thing as a want for human intervention. Many corporations are racing to get to Stage 5.

Cruise mentioned it reached Stage 4 autonomy, though human operators did monitor the experience remotely, in response to The New York Occasions. After some high-profile accidents, Cruise was shut down by GM, which acquired the startup in 2016. GM reportedly plowed about $10 billion into Cruise.

In the meantime, Waymo has raised a complete of $11 billion as of final October, in response to CNBC. Alphabet dedicated to $5 billion.

Tesla, regardless of providing a full self-driving (FSD) function to clients, solely operates at a Stage 2 autonomy — that means the automobile will help the driving force with acceleration, braking and steering however the drive stays engaged. Firm CEO Elon Musk famously dislikes LiDAR and selected to make use of solely cameras for Teslas. Nonetheless, The Verge stories that Tesla has been shopping for up LiDAR sensors.

Enterprise Insider mentioned Tesla has employed a whole lot of in-house autonomous check drivers to meet Musk’s promise of bringing a robotaxi to market this yr.
